Cómo agregar publicaciones relacionadas en WordPress sin usar complementos
Cómo agregar publicaciones relacionadas en WordPress sin usar complementos
Para “Publicación relacionada” o “Artículos relacionados” son una serie de complementootros más sofisticados, pero al final todos hacen lo mismo. Muestra en una página (en un post) del blog los títulos de los artículos que corresponden como materia al artículo en el que se realiza el listado. Es una función útil para ambos. SEO así como para usuario, permitiendo un acceso rápido a artículos que tratan del mismo tema que el de la página en la que se realiza el listado.
Se sabe que un gran número de complemento-ers pueden tener una influencia negativa el tiempo de carga de una página y además crea tablas adicionales en la base de datos.
Una buena idea sería reemplazar tantos complementos de WordPress como sea posible con líneas de código que conduzcan al mismo resultado. (Precaución, sin embargo, porque algunos códigos agregados especialmente en funciones.php pueden afectar seriamente el rendimiento del servidor)

Los complementos de “Publicaciones relacionadas” se puede reemplazar con la función a continuación, si elegimos tenerla en la página del artículo títulos de artículos mostrados que contienen las mismas etiquetas con los del puesto en el que figura. Usando este criterio de relación, podemos agregar el siguiente código al archivo single.php del tema utilizado en el blog.
<?php
$tags = wp_get_post_tags($post->ID);
if ($tags) {
$tag_ids = array();
foreach($tags as $individual_tag) $tag_ids[] = $individual_tag->term_id;
$args=array(
'tag__in' => $tag_ids,
'post__not_in' => array($post->ID),
'showposts'=>5, // Number of related posts that will be shown.
'caller_get_posts'=>1
);
$my_query = new wp_query($args);
if( $my_query->have_posts() ) {
echo '<h3>Related Posts</h3><ul>';
while ($my_query->have_posts()) {
$my_query->the_post();
?>
<li><a href="<?php the_permalink() ?>" rel="bookmark" title="Permanent Link to <?php the_title_attribute(); ?>"><?php the_title(); ?></a></li>
<?php
}
echo '</ul>';
}
}
?>
Ejemplo concreto.
En la página del artículo. “EXPLOIT DE WORDPRESS: LIMPIEZA DE ARCHIVOS VIRUSADOS, SQL Y SEGURIDAD DEL SERVIDOR.” los relacionados con WordPress, virus, bases de datos y exploits se enumeran como artículos relacionados.

La función se prueba en WordPress 3.3.1 pero también es compatible con versiones más recientes de Wordpress 2.x.
Stealth Settings – Mostrar publicación relacionada en WordPress sin un complemento.
Cómo agregar publicaciones relacionadas en WordPress sin usar complementos
Qué hay de nuevo
Acerca de Stealth L.P.
Fundador y editor Stealth Settings, din 2006 pana in prezent. Experienta pe sistemele de operare Linux (in special CentOS), Mac OS X , Windows XP > Windows 10 SI WordPress (CMS).
Ver todas las publicaciones de Stealth L.P.También te puede interesar...
un pensamiento sobre “Cómo agregar publicaciones relacionadas en WordPress sin usar complementos”